Our Mission The Elmwood Avenue Festival of the Arts mission is to foster growth in, and awareness of, Western New York's artistic and cultural treasures and improve the fabric of our unique urban environment. Goals To give regional artists, crafts people, musicians, arts organizations and community groups a family-oriented venue in which to present their work, and to help foster the creation and growth of these grassroots enterprises. Create a children's festival that celebrates and educates through the Arts. Offering hands-on art projects, some collaborative, that bring together children of all ages, backgrounds, and abilities. Commission and fund public art, tree plantings, and other beautification projects. Highlight the richness of the Elmwood Village stores, restaurants, and people. We plan on accomplishing this by seeking regional artists and developing marketplaces for them in cooperation with neighborhood businesses, regional arts organizations, galleries, colleges and universities, and our sponsors. We feel that providing such a venue is an economic development tool for the neighborhood, city, region, and state.
